excel如何同时筛选多个数据库
在Excel中同时筛选多个数据库,可以采用以下几种方法:,,1. **使用高级筛选功能**:准备一个条件区域,列出筛选条件,确保条件区域与数据区域不重叠。选中数据区域,点击“数据”菜单中的“高级”按钮,选择“将筛选结果复制到其他位置”,并设置好相应的参数。,,2. **使用Power Query工具**:如果Excel版本支持Power Query(如Excel 2016及更高版本),可以通过“数据”选项卡下的“从其他源”或“获取数据”按钮来加载多个数据库。在Power Query编辑器中,可以对每个数据库执行不同的查询和筛选操作,然后将它们合并为一个新的查询。,,3. **合并多个数据表**:如果需要同时筛选的数据来自不同的工作表或数据表,可以先将这些数据表合并到一个主数据表中。这可以通过“数据”选项卡下的“合并计算”功能实现。合并后,可以在主数据表中进行统一的筛选操作。,,4. **使用公式筛选**:结合使用Excel的函数(如IF、AND、OR等)和筛选功能,可以根据复杂的条件筛选数据。可以使用IF函数创建一个辅助列,根据特定条件标记行,然后通过常规筛选功能筛选出标记的行。,,在Excel中同时筛选多个数据库有多种方法可选,每种方法都有其特点和适用场景。用户应根据具体需求和数据情况选择合适的方法来实现高效的数据筛选。
Excel中同时筛选多个数据库的详细方法
在Excel中,有时需要对多个数据库进行筛选以提取特定数据,虽然Excel没有直接提供“多数据库筛选”功能,但可以通过一些技巧和方法来实现这一目标,以下是详细的步骤和示例,帮助你在Excel中同时筛选多个数据库:

1. 准备工作
假设你有两个数据库,分别位于不同的工作表中,Sheet1和Sheet2,每个工作表中的数据结构相同,包含以下列:ID、姓名、年龄、部门,你需要从这两个工作表中筛选出年龄大于30岁的人员信息。
2. 使用高级筛选功能
2.1 创建一个筛选条件区域
在一个空白区域(Sheet3)中创建一个筛选条件区域,这个区域应该至少包含与你的数据库相同的列标题,并指定筛选条件。
ID 姓名 年龄 部门 >302.2 使用高级筛选功能对第一个数据库进行筛选
1、选择数据范围:在Sheet1中选择整个数据范围(包括标题行)。
2、打开高级筛选对话框:点击Excel顶部菜单中的“数据”选项卡,然后选择“高级”。
3、设置筛选条件:
列表区域:选择Sheet1中的数据范围。
筛选器复制到:选择一个空白单元格(A10),用于存放筛选结果。
筛选范围:选择之前创建的条件区域(Sheet3!A1:D2)。
4、确认筛选:点击“确定”按钮,筛选结果将显示在你指定的单元格区域(A10开始的区域)。
2.3 对第二个数据库重复以上步骤
1、选择数据范围:在Sheet2中选择整个数据范围(包括标题行)。
2、打开高级筛选对话框:再次点击Excel顶部菜单中的“数据”选项卡,然后选择“高级”。

3、设置筛选条件:
列表区域:选择Sheet2中的数据范围。
筛选器复制到:选择另一个空白单元格区域(B10),用于存放第二个数据库的筛选结果。
筛选范围:选择之前创建的条件区域(Sheet3!A1:D2)。
4、确认筛选:点击“确定”按钮,第二个数据库的筛选结果将显示在你指定的单元格区域(B10开始的区域)。
3. 合并筛选结果
你已经分别从两个数据库中筛选出了符合条件的记录,可以使用Excel的其他功能(如合并和删除重复项)来合并这些结果。
1、复制筛选结果:将Sheet1和Sheet2中的筛选结果分别复制到新的工作表(Sheet4)的不同区域。
2、使用VLOOKUP或INDEX/MATCH函数合并数据:如果你希望根据特定列(如ID)合并数据,可以使用VLOOKUP或INDEX/MATCH函数。
3、删除重复项:如果合并后的数据中有重复项,可以使用Excel的“删除重复项”功能来清理数据。
4. 示例操作步骤
以下是一个具体的操作示例:
1、创建条件区域:在Sheet3中输入筛选条件(如上所述)。
2、对Sheet1进行筛选:
选择Sheet1的数据范围(A1:D10)。
打开高级筛选对话框,设置列表区域为Sheet1!A1:D10,筛选器复制到Sheet4!A1,筛选范围为Sheet3!A1:D2。

点击“确定”,筛选结果显示在Sheet4的A列。
3、对Sheet2进行筛选:
选择Sheet2的数据范围(A1:D10)。
打开高级筛选对话框,设置列表区域为Sheet2!A1:D10,筛选器复制到Sheet4!B1,筛选范围为Sheet3!A1:D2。
点击“确定”,筛选结果显示在Sheet4的B列。
4、合并结果:在Sheet4中使用VLOOKUP函数根据ID列合并两列数据,并删除重复项。
相关问答FAQs
Q1:如果多个数据库的结构不同,如何进行筛选?
A1:如果多个数据库的结构不同,建议先对每个数据库进行单独的筛选,然后将结果复制到一个新的工作表中,在新工作表中,可以使用Excel的各种函数(如IF、VLOOKUP等)根据共同的关键字或字段进行匹配和合并,根据需要进行进一步的清理和格式化。
Q2:是否可以使用VBA宏来实现多数据库筛选?
A2:是的,使用VBA宏可以实现更复杂的多数据库筛选操作,通过编写VBA代码,你可以自动化地遍历多个工作表,应用筛选条件,并将结果汇总到一个新的工作表中,这需要一定的VBA编程知识,但可以大大提高效率和灵活性,如果你不熟悉VBA,可以从网上查找相关的教程和示例代码来学习。
小编有话说
在Excel中同时筛选多个数据库虽然不是直接支持的功能,但通过上述方法,我们可以灵活地实现这一需求,无论是使用高级筛选功能还是结合VBA编程,都能帮助你高效地处理多个数据库中的数据,希望这篇教程能对你有所帮助!如果你有更多问题或需要进一步的帮助,请随时留言讨论。
以上就是关于“excel如何同时筛选多个数据库”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
相关阅读
-
win10怎么快速关闭屏幕?win10快速关闭屏幕方法
估计很多用 Win10 的人都会想要快速锁屏来保护个人隐私,但是也有人不知道怎么快速关掉屏幕。其实很简单,你可以直接按 Win + L 快捷键,或者右键点击桌面上的空白地方,然后选择快捷方式就可以啦。下面我们就来详细说一下 Win10 快速
-
苹果iOS 17.4 Beta版开放侧载功能,但iPad不在列
1月27日消息,苹果公司近日针对欧盟《数字市场法》作出了响应,上线了iOS 17.4 Beta版,向欧盟用户开放了侧载功能。然而,尽管iPadOS与iOS在本质上并无太大差异,但iPad并不支持侧载功能。这意味着,安装第三方应用商店以及从第
-
Win11系统intel核显控制面板怎么打开-打开intel核显控制面板的方法
你晓得吗?有些小伙伴想开自己电脑的intel核显控制面板来看显卡驱动信息。里面可以检查更新驱动。但是,他们不知道怎么开这个面板。如果也想试试看的话,可以看看下面的操作方法哦!打开intel核显控制面板的方法1. 右键桌面空白处,就能打开英特
-
极氪20万台新能源汽车里程碑达成
1月8日消息,国内新能源汽车市场再传捷报。极氪汽车今日欣喜公布,经过26个月的不懈努力,其累计交付汽车数量已突破20万台大关。这一成就不仅彰显了极氪在新能源领域的强劲实力,更使其持续刷新着新势力品牌的最快交付纪录,同时保持着全球唯一的新能源
-
Windows10玩GTA5闪退怎么解决?Windows10玩GTA5闪退解决方法
Windows10玩GTA5闪退怎么解决?GTA5是一款非常知名的游戏,很多的玩家都在畅玩,但是很多的用户们在玩耍这一款游戏的时候,遇到了自己电脑玩GTA5会闪退,这个问题我们怎么解决呢?下面小编为大家带来详细的解决方法介绍,快来看看吧!
-
极氪第二款MPV车型“CM2E”谍照曝光,或于2024年上半年亮相
1月17日消息,近日,知名汽车博主@SugarDesign在社交媒体上发布了极氪品牌旗下第二款MPV车型——内部代号“CM2E”的谍照。据推测,新车可能为小型MPV,有望于2024年上半年与大家正式见面。 从曝光的谍照中可以看出,极氪CM

